Commit 9c8509d0 authored by rniwa@webkit.org's avatar rniwa@webkit.org

Enable HTMLTemplateElement by default

https://bugs.webkit.org/show_bug.cgi?id=123851

Reviewed by Antti Koivisto.

.: 

* Source/autotools/SetupWebKitFeatures.m4:
* Source/cmake/WebKitFeatures.cmake:

Source/WTF: 

* wtf/FeatureDefines.h:

Tools: 

* Scripts/webkitperl/FeatureList.pm:


git-svn-id: http://svn.webkit.org/repository/webkit/trunk@160156 268f45cc-cd09-0410-ab3c-d52691b4dbfc
parent 0dc16c34
2013-12-04 Ryosuke Niwa <rniwa@webkit.org>
Enable HTMLTemplateElement by default
https://bugs.webkit.org/show_bug.cgi?id=123851
Reviewed by Antti Koivisto.
* Source/autotools/SetupWebKitFeatures.m4:
* Source/cmake/WebKitFeatures.cmake:
2013-12-04 László Langó <lango@inf.u-szeged.hu>
Allow --cloop option to work correctly in case of EFL.
......
2013-12-04 Ryosuke Niwa <rniwa@webkit.org>
Enable HTMLTemplateElement by default
https://bugs.webkit.org/show_bug.cgi?id=123851
Reviewed by Antti Koivisto.
* wtf/FeatureDefines.h:
2013-12-04 Dan Bernstein <mitz@apple.com>
Replace USE(SECURITY_FRAMEWORK) with finer-grained defines
......
......@@ -785,7 +785,7 @@
#endif
#if !defined(ENABLE_TEMPLATE_ELEMENT)
#define ENABLE_TEMPLATE_ELEMENT 0
#define ENABLE_TEMPLATE_ELEMENT 1
#endif
#if !defined(ENABLE_TEXT_AUTOSIZING)
......
......@@ -171,7 +171,7 @@ $srcdir/Tools/gtk/generate-feature-defines-files $CONFIGURABLE_FEATURE_DEFINES \
ENABLE_SMOOTH_SCROLLING=1 \
ENABLE_SQL_DATABASE=1 \
ENABLE_SUBPIXEL_LAYOUT=1 \
ENABLE_TEMPLATE_ELEMENT=0 \
ENABLE_TEMPLATE_ELEMENT=1 \
ENABLE_TEXT_AUTOSIZING=0 \
ENABLE_THREADED_HTML_PARSER=0 \
ENABLE_TOUCH_EVENTS=0 \
......
......@@ -113,7 +113,7 @@ macro(WEBKIT_OPTION_BEGIN)
WEBKIT_OPTION_DEFINE(ENABLE_SQL_DATABASE "Toggle SQL Database Support" ON)
WEBKIT_OPTION_DEFINE(ENABLE_SVG "Toggle SVG support" ON)
WEBKIT_OPTION_DEFINE(ENABLE_SVG_FONTS "Toggle SVG fonts support (imples SVG support)" ON)
WEBKIT_OPTION_DEFINE(ENABLE_TEMPLATE_ELEMENT "Toggle Template support" OFF)
WEBKIT_OPTION_DEFINE(ENABLE_TEMPLATE_ELEMENT "Toggle Template support" ON)
WEBKIT_OPTION_DEFINE(ENABLE_TEXT_AUTOSIZING "Toggle Text auto sizing support" OFF)
WEBKIT_OPTION_DEFINE(ENABLE_THREADED_HTML_PARSER, "Toggle threaded HTML parser support" OFF)
WEBKIT_OPTION_DEFINE(ENABLE_TOUCH_EVENTS "Toggle Touch Events support" OFF)
......
2013-12-04 Ryosuke Niwa <rniwa@webkit.org>
Enable HTMLTemplateElement by default
https://bugs.webkit.org/show_bug.cgi?id=123851
Reviewed by Antti Koivisto.
* Scripts/webkitperl/FeatureList.pm:
2013-12-04 Jozsef Berta <jberta@inf.u-szeged.hu>
[EFL] Bumping GStreamer version to 1.2.1
......
......@@ -426,7 +426,7 @@ my @features = (
define => "USE_SYSTEM_MALLOC", default => (isBlackBerry() || isWinCE()), value => \$systemMallocSupport },
{ option => "template-element", desc => "Toggle HTMLTemplateElement support",
define => "ENABLE_TEMPLATE_ELEMENT", default => (isAppleWebKit() || isEfl() || isGtk()), value => \$templateElementSupport },
define => "ENABLE_TEMPLATE_ELEMENT", default => 1, value => \$templateElementSupport },
{ option => "text-autosizing", desc => "Toggle Text Autosizing support",
define => "ENABLE_TEXT_AUTOSIZING", default => isBlackBerry(), value => \$textAutosizingSupport },
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ment